// OFFLINE_SYNC_WINDOW_HOURS: max age of cached survey forms in
// Groundlark's field app before a forced re-sync. Raised from 24
// to 72 after crews in the Hollis Basin pilot lost connectivity
// for whole shifts and got locked out of data entry. Do not lower
// without checking conflict-merge coverage in sync_test. Change
// validated against the canary build referenced below.

pipeline stamp: htk9_ce63042d9

Subject: On-call heads-up — Orchardly catalog cache. Welcome aboard. The main gotcha: catalog price updates invalidate by SKU, but bundle pages cache composite keys, so a stale bundle can outlive its parts. If support reports wrong bundle prices, purge the composite namespace first. We'll cover this at the weekly sync; the invalidation playbook is on this internal page.

wiki page, yagef-tawif: https://sentry.lumicdata.local/view/merge_requests/pipeline/merge_requests/e08f7f35c80b5755

### Key Ceremony Checklist — Item 7 (Restockr Planner)

Before generating the signing keys for the Restockr vending-machine restock planner's plugin API, confirm all three custodians are present and the ceremony room recorder is running. Verify the hardware token's tamper seal is intact. To initialize the token, the lead custodian must enter the recovery passphrase below.

strongbox words: fraath-isteth